What is CityBase?

CityBase
SoftwareFinancial Software

Founded in 2013 and headquartered in Chicago, CityBase provides a comprehensive suite of digital tools designed to streamline interactions between citizens, businesses, and public sector entities. By integrating payment processing, constituent service portals, and robust API development, the company effectively bridges the gap between legacy government systems and modern user expectations. Its market position is defined by its ability to serve as a critical middleware layer for cities, states, and utility providers, facilitating seamless digital transformation in the public sector.

How much funding has CityBase raised?

CityBase has raised a total of $16.1M across 4 funding rounds:

Series A (2015): $4M with participation from Method Capital and Taylor Capital

Series B (2016): $9.1M led by Method Capital

Debt (2018): $1M, investors not publicly disclosed

Debt (2020): $2M featuring PPP
